I can answer the hypervisor question for you.  The statement about keeping 
hypervisors patched is a bit of a catch-all to try to make sure that if there 
is an issue in someone's cloud, that CloudStack doesn't automatically get the 
blame (we find issues are more often hypervisor related rather than CloudStack 
related).  But as you've highlighted, that's a double edge sword.

I'd saying that with vSphere, we use the VMware java libraries to do the 
orchestration of vSphere via vCenter, so the likelihood of any vSphere update 
within a version causing something to break is minimal.  That said, I only know 
of community testing of 4.11 against 6.5GA at this time, the standard advice is 
- make sure that you test it thoroughly before trying anything new in 
production (and ideally let everyone in the community know the results).

As I recall 4.9 was not completely reliable with vSphere 6.5; the forthcoming 
4.11 will be.

Hi

The compatibility matrix for Cloudstack 4.9+ lists specific minor OS versions 
for the management server with the exception of CentOS 7 which doesn't include 
a minor version.  Is a fully patched CentOS 7 (7.4-1708) installation therefore 
supported? What happens with future minor OS releases, are these tested and 
supported as they are released?

The VMware 6.5 GA hypervisor is listed as supported in the compatibility matrix 
but in the installation guide it states "Be sure all the hotfixes provided by 
the hypervisor vendor are applied." Does this mean that VMware 6.5 U1 with 
latest patches is therefore supported too? What happens with future VMware 
hypervisor releases, are these tested and supported as they are released?
